Selection of agents modulating gastrointestinal pain
The present embodiments relate to selection of agents effective in reducing or preventing gastrointestinal pain in a subject. Such an agent is selected and identified if it is capable of reducing spontaneous and/or induced transient receptor potential vanilloid 1 (TRPV1) activation.
1. A method for selecting a lactic acid bacterial strain for reducing gastrointestinal pain locally in a subject, said method comprising:
contacting a cell expressing transient receptor potential vanilloid 1 (TRPV1) with the bacterial strain;
measuring spontaneous and/or induced TRPV1 activation in said cell following the contacting; and
selecting said bacterial strain effective in reducing gastrointestinal pain locally when said measured spontaneous and/or induced TRPV1 activation is lower than control TRPV1 activation.
2. The method according to claim 1 , wherein measuring said spontaneous and/or induced TRPV1 activation comprises measuring Ca2+ influx in said cell induced by capsaicin, pH change and/or heat.
3. The method according to claim 1 , wherein measuring said spontaneous and/or induced TRPV1 activation comprises measuring temperature-gated ion-channel activity in said cell.
